Endless hot water without a bulky tank taking up valuable floor space
Continuous flow systems heat water the moment it moves through the exchanger, so the last shower of the morning runs as hot as the first. No cupboard or balcony surrenders its floor to a storage tank, which is exactly the trade locals want to make.

What we do with continuous flow
From tank-to-instant conversions to descaling a temperamental exchanger, these are the jobs we carry out on continuous flow systems across the local towers and cottages, each finished with testing, temperature setting and a fixed written quote:
Instant system conversions
Converting from an old electric tank to a continuous flow unit frees up the laundry cupboard or balcony wall, and we size the flow rate to match every outlet running at once across your household on a typically busy morning.
Gas continuous flow
Gas units deliver the strongest flow for the least running cost where a gas main or bottle bank already exists, and we check your meter capacity and flue route before quoting rather than discovering a costly problem on installation day.
Electric continuous flow
Electric instant units suit apartments without gas and without external flue options, mounting compactly on a wall inside the bathroom or cupboard, though we verify your power supply and cabling can honestly and safely carry the load before recommending one.
Servicing and descaling
Continuous flow units in hard-water areas scale up their heat exchangers over the years, so a periodic flush and service keeps temperature steady and preserves the manufacturer warranty, which beats an early replacement by a wide margin every single time.

Common problems we fix
Temperature swings
Water lurching between hot and cold while someone runs a tap elsewhere usually means the unit is undersized for genuine simultaneous demand, and a flow-rate check against your household's real usage tells us quickly whether a bigger unit is warranted.
Fault codes and ignition failures
Modern units flash fault codes when ignition fails, the gas supply starves or a sensor drifts out of range, and we carry diagnostic gear and common parts on the van so most codes are usually resolved on the first visit.
Cold water sandwich
That burst of lukewarm water between two hot spells is a classic continuous-flow quirk as the heat exchanger pauses briefly between draws, and a small recirculation loop or tempering adjustment usually tames it entirely without replacing a healthy unit.

Why upgrading before the old tank dies pays off
Choosing continuous flow is not only about endless showers; the decision shapes running costs, space and how the household copes when everyone wants hot water at once, and these are the outcomes worth weighing:
Nobody draws the short straw anymore
A correctly sized instant unit keeps temperature stable no matter how many outlets run at once, so the person showering second gets the same comfort as the person who got up first.
Running costs follow actual use
The system burns energy only while water flows, which suits busy households that shower at scattered times, and gas models in particular undercut old electric storage over a year.
You reclaim the space
Removing a tank from a cupboard, balcony or laundry corner returns genuinely usable floor area to a compact apartment, and wall-mounted units sit tidily where a cylinder never could.

Instant hot water questions locals ask us
How long does an instant hot water system last?
A quality continuous flow unit typically serves fifteen to twenty years with periodic servicing, and because the heat exchanger is the main wearing part, flushing it regularly extends that span considerably.
Can you install instant systems in local apartments?
Yes, compact wall-mounted units suit the local towers well, and we coordinate building-manager access, confirm riser isolation and verify power and gas capacity properly before quoting the fixed written price.
Are instant systems less expensive to run?
Gas continuous flow units usually cost less to run than electric storage because they heat only on demand, while electric instant units suit homes without gas but draw heavily while operating.
Do older gas lines cope with a continuous flow unit?
The pre-1940 cottages on the southern streets often carry original gas fittings, so we assess supply capacity and upgrade the run to current standards where needed before connecting the new unit.
What size instant system does a family need?
Sizing comes down to outlets running at once rather than household storage, so we calculate the litres per minute your showers and taps demand together, then match a unit accordingly.
Do instant units need servicing?
An annual or biennial service flushing the heat exchanger prevents scale buildup, holds output temperature where you set it and keeps the manufacturer warranty intact, costing far less than replacing the whole unit early.
